Comparison of the results

Output Characteristics Without Wastewater Reuse

Wastewater Reuse Model 1

Wastewater ReuseModel 2

Fresh water feed required 7,2 kg/s 2,2 kg/s 0 kg/s

Acrylonitrile in product stream

3,9 kg/s 4,4 kg/s 4,6 kg/s

Flow rate to treatment 13,1 kg/s 7,7 kg/s 5,0 kg/s

Mass fraction acrylonitrilein stream sent to treatment

0,092 0,078 0,083

Concentration of ammonia in stream sent to treatment

20 ppm 35 ppm 25 ppm

Concentration of ammonia in product stream

1 ppm 2 ppm 1 ppm
